As Kloten's team manager Pascal Müller confirms to the Tages-Anzeiger, Tommi Santala will leave EHC Kloten with immediate effect.

The 37-year-old forward, who has played in 462 games for Kloten (413 points), requested to be released from the team in order to be able to join a KHL team. Which team exactly he will sign with has not been disclosed, but, as the same source speculates, it could be Metallurg Magnitogorsk.

Team manager Müller did not see the Finn's request coming, especially as they had negotiated with the forward about a contract extension. He does, however, not see any reason to hold him back: "There is no point in keeping a player against his will." Now, Kloten will have to look at the import-player market once again.
